Fuel Emergency As 20+ Flights Divert Or Hold After Man Breaches Manchester Airport
A security breach at Manchester Airport (MAN) left more than 20 flights disrupted on Friday night and into the early hours of Saturday, including one TUI flight that declared a low fuel emergency. The airport was forced to suspend arrivals after a man made his way onto the active airfield, with seven flights diverting to other UK airports and 17 more entering prolonged holding patterns.

United Completes Phase One Expansion of World’s Largest Pilot Training Facility
United and CAE today celebrated the first phase of expansion at the world’s largest pilot training facility, adding 40 new CAE training devices (a combination of full-motion and fixed simulators) since 2022.
United’s Flight Training Center in Denver now has eight total buildings, nearly 700,000 square feet of training space, the equivalent of 12 football fields, and a total of 86 CAE training devices: 52 state-of-the-art full-motion flight simulators and 34 fixed training devices.

SUNDANCE MOUNTAIN RESORT ANNOUNCES NEW HIGH-SPEED QUAD LIFT AND RIDGE RUN FOR 2026/2027 SKI SEASON
This winter season, Sundance Mountain Resort will reveal over 100 acres of new terrain, marked by Electric Horseman, a brand-new high-speed quad lift and Storyteller, a 1.7 mile groomed ridge run. This expansion concludes the resort’s first phase of its back mountain expansion, bringing the total acreage to 605 acres of pristine skiing and snowboarding, while looking ahead to additional expert terrain growth across future seasons.
